Who is Cheslin Kolbe

Cheslin Kolbe is a South African winger and fullback born on 28 October 1993 in Kraaifontein, Western Cape, renowned for his elusive footwork and explosive pace despite standing just 1.71m tall. He scored one of the greatest tries in Rugby World Cup Final history against England in 2019, helping South Africa win 32–12. Kolbe has played his club rugby in France for Toulouse and RC Toulon.
